Where the time goes

Medical and dental practices see the same patterns regardless of specialty.

The #1 pattern

Speed-to-lead: inbound response latency

Prospect sends an inquiry at 9pm. You see it at 8am. By then they've already called two competitors. Cutting that lag from hours to minutes is often worth more than everything else on this page combined.

Patient intake and forms

Insurance verification, records transfer, new-patient paperwork.

Scheduling and no-show follow-up

Reminder sequences, reschedules, confirmations.

Post-visit summaries and treatment plans

Drafted from scratch for each patient. Routine structure, detailed content.

Insurance and billing correspondence

Denial follow-ups, claim resubmissions, patient billing questions.

Where AI works in this business — and where it shouldn't

Three categories: workflows AI absorbs cleanly, workflows AI assists with but a human owns, and workflows that stay fully human. The Assessment narrows this down to your specific firm.

Where AI fits in this business — workflow, AI fit category, and what to do
WorkflowAI fitWhat that means
Patient intake forms, insurance verification, records transferAI absorbs cleanlyFront-desk admin where a missed step costs the operatory time. Direct fit.
Reminder, confirmation, and no-show follow-up sequencesAI absorbs cleanlyA messaging cadence the front desk can no longer keep up with by hand.
Post-visit summaries, treatment-plan drafts, review requestsAI assists, human signs offDrafted from templates; clinician edits and signs before send.
Clinical diagnosis, treatment decisions, chair-side judgementStays fully humanAnything that touches patient outcomes or the chart stays clinician-owned.

What I won't tell you to automate

Half the value of this Assessment is the workflows I tell you to leave alone. Here's where I'll push back.

Cold outbound

Your sales motion

Automated cold sequences destroy more trust than they generate. Your sales motion needs more human attention, not less.

Process first

Broken processes

If clients are unhappy or staff is burned out, AI on top only speeds up the problem. Fix the process first.

Judgment call

Human-judgement work

Client calls, review that requires context, anything where your reputation is on the line. These stay human. That's your edge.

Low volume

Low-volume tasks

If the task happens twice a month, setup cost is higher than the time you'd save. Keep it manual.
